Tasting notes:
On colour
Villion Wines Blanc de l’Atlantique 2022 shows a pale lemon to lemon-gold colour with bright, youthful reflections, suggesting a fresh, aromatic white blended from cooler coastal-origin fruit.
On the nose
The nose is expressive and perfumed, opening with intense jasmine and orange blossom, ripe peach and apricot, and subtle tropical tones, layered with sweet baking spice, hints of vanilla and a touch of caramel over a clean, fresh core.
On the palate
The palate is dry with a mouth-watering entry and medium body, echoing juicy stone fruits and gentle tropical notes wrapped in soft spice, while a lively, dominant freshness and well-judged alcohol keep the wine poised, flowing into a nicely persistent, aromatic finish.
On the whole
An intensely aromatic yet refreshing coastal white, combining ripe stone fruit richness with floral lift and bright acidity.
Aging potential:
Perfect now but will show different faces within the next 5 – 10 years.
